These data were then used … WebFeb 25, 2024 · Maximal oxygen consumption (VO 2max) is a key indicator of health and cardiorespiratory fitness [ 1] and is considered a “clinical vital sign” and strong predictor of mortality [ 2 ]. The traditional, gold standard method to assess VO 2max is open circuit spirometry in conjunction with a graded exercise test (GXT) to volitional fatigue.

WebOxygen consumption (VO 2) at the self-selected treadmill walking speed averaged 64% of peak oxygen consumption (VO 2peak). Submaximal VO 2levels exceeded 70% of VO 2peak in 30% of the subjects.
